@media (max-width: 991px){
.frame-layout-2 {
	padding-left: 5%;
	padding-right: 5%;
}
.frame-gallerygrid img {
	width: 100%;
	height: 320px;
	object-fit: cover;
}  
}
@media (max-width: 767px){
.frame-gallerygrid img {
	width: 100%;
	height: 250px;
	object-fit: cover;
}  
.content .ce-textpic.ce-left.ce-intext {
	display: flex;
	flex-direction: column;
}  
.content .ce-textpic.ce-left.ce-intext .ce-bodytext {
	padding-left: 0;
  padding-top:20px;
}  
.partner .image-embed-item {
	width: 100%;
	height: auto;
}  
}
@media (max-width: 575px){
.frame-gallerygrid img {
	width: 100%;
	height: 40vw;
	object-fit: cover;
}
}
@media (min-width: 992px) AND (max-width:1199px){
.frame-gallerygrid img {
	width: 100%;
	height: 220px;
	object-fit: cover;
}
}
@media (min-width: 992px){
.navbar-expand-lg .navbar-nav {
    padding-left: 0;
} 
}

@media (min-width: 1200px)
  